首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

有没有办法更新一个功能文件中的头文件并使用Karate.config.js中的Auth令牌?

是的,您可以使用Karate提供的karate-config.js文件来更新功能文件中的头文件,并在karate-config.js中使用身份验证令牌。以下是一种可能的方法:

  1. 首先,确保您已经设置了Karate测试环境并在karate-config.js中配置了所需的身份验证令牌。您可以使用以下代码示例作为参考:
代码语言:txt
复制
function fn() {
  var config = {
    baseUrl: 'https://example.com',
    authToken: 'your-auth-token'
  };
  return config;
}
  1. 在您的功能文件中,使用karate-config.js文件中配置的变量来设置请求头文件。例如:
代码语言:txt
复制
Feature: 更新头文件

Background:
* url baseUrl

Scenario: 更新功能文件中的头文件并使用Auth令牌
Given path 'api/some-endpoint'
And headers {
  'Authorization': 'Bearer ' + authToken
}
...

请注意,在此示例中,baseUrlauthToken是来自karate-config.js文件的配置变量。

  1. 运行您的Karate测试,并确保karate-config.js中的身份验证令牌正确应用于功能文件中的请求头文件。

上述方法可以帮助您更新功能文件中的头文件,并使用karate-config.js中的身份验证令牌。请根据您的具体需求进行调整和修改。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

17分41秒

FL Studio 21中文版强悍来袭!AI编曲插件,比你想象的更强大!!!

2分22秒

Elastic Security 操作演示:上传脚本并修复安全威胁

5分41秒

040_缩进几个字符好_输出所有键盘字符_循环遍历_indent

107
4分29秒

MySQL命令行监控工具 - mysqlstat 介绍

5分33秒

JSP 在线学习系统myeclipse开发mysql数据库web结构java编程

8分3秒

Windows NTFS 16T分区上限如何破,无损调整块大小到8192的需求如何实现?

16分8秒

人工智能新途-用路由器集群模仿神经元集群

26分40秒

晓兵技术杂谈2-intel_daos用户态文件系统io路径_dfuse_io全路径_io栈_c语言

3.4K
1时5分

云拨测多方位主动式业务监控实战

领券